淘先锋技术网

首页 1 2 3 4 5 6 7

AJAX是一种用于在不刷新整个页面的情况下从服务器获取数据的技术。它能够在后台与服务器进行数据交互,然后使用返回的数据来更新页面的内容。其中一种常见的AJAX请求是GET请求,它可以从服务器获取数据并将其显示在页面上。本文将介绍AJAX的GET请求,包括它的基本语法和一些常见的应用场景。

使用AJAX的GET请求非常简单。我们只需要通过一个URL来请求数据,并指定一个回调函数来处理返回的数据即可。以下是一个示例:

$.ajax({
url: 'https://api.example.com/data',
method: 'GET',
success: function(response) {
// 处理返回的数据
console.log(response);
}
});

在上面的代码中,我们使用了jQuery的AJAX函数来发起一个GET请求。我们指定了一个URL,即我们希望从服务器获取数据的地址。我们还指定了GET作为请求的方法。在成功收到数据后,回调函数将会被触发,并将返回的数据作为参数。

GET请求可以用于各种不同的场景。以下是一些常见的应用示例:

1. 获取用户信息:我们可以使用GET请求来获取用户的个人信息。例如,我们可以向服务器发送一个GET请求,以获取指定用户的姓名、年龄、电子邮件等详细信息。

$.ajax({
url: 'https://api.example.com/user',
method: 'GET',
data: {
id: '123'
},
success: function(response) {
// 处理返回的用户信息
console.log(response);
}
});

2. 加载新闻内容:我们可以使用GET请求来加载新闻内容。例如,我们可以向服务器发送一个GET请求,以获取最新的新闻标题、内容和发布日期。

$.ajax({
url: 'https://api.example.com/news',
method: 'GET',
success: function(response) {
// 处理返回的新闻内容
console.log(response);
}
});

3. 动态搜索:我们可以使用GET请求来进行动态搜索。例如,在一个文本输入框中输入关键词时,我们可以使用GET请求将关键词发送给服务器,并从服务器获取匹配的搜索结果。

$.ajax({
url: 'https://api.example.com/search',
method: 'GET',
data: {
keyword: 'apple'
},
success: function(response) {
// 处理返回的搜索结果
console.log(response);
}
});

总结起来,AJAX的GET请求是一种强大的技术,可以帮助我们在不刷新整个页面的情况下从服务器获取数据。它可以用于各种不同的场景,例如获取用户信息、加载新闻内容和进行动态搜索。希望本文对你了解AJAX的GET请求有所帮助。